Delegation of the Embassy of the Netherlands toured the Main Building and met with academics and staff
The guests arrived on 9 December.
The delegation comprised Counsellor for Trade and Economy Nora Dessing, Attaché for Innovation, Technology and Science Sibe Nordmeyer, and Senior Assistant of the Department of Trade and Economy Yulia Smirnova.
Kazan University was represented by Counsellor to the Rector for International Cooperation Linar Latypov, Director of the International Office Olga Vershinina, Deputy Director of the Institute of International relations Liliya Ilikova, Deputy Director of the Institute of Design and Spatial Arts Yelena Denisenko, and Director of the School of Arts of the Institute of Design and Spatial Arts Elza Bashirova.
Mr. Nordmeyer noted that Netherlandish scientists are interested in developing cooperation in astronomy, life sciences, and chemistry. “This is my first visit to Kazan Federal University. I’ve been impressed by the University’s history, this magnificent building, and the fact that Leo Tolstoy himself was a student,” he said.
